Domingas is a given name, with more bearers in Brazil than in any other country. In Angola it is the 32nd most common given name. It appears chiefly in Portuguese and English, written in the Latin script. Recorded meaning: second-person singular present indicative of domingar.

Domingas in IBGE — names by decade (Kaggle mirror), Brazil, 1930–2022
Yearrecords
193017
19401,809
19505,540
196011,638
197018,463
198024,169
199028,332
200030,087
201030,679
202030,811
202230,834

BR IBGE — names by decade (Kaggle mirror)11 years between 1930–2022. One register's own figures, never a sum across registers: two registers counting the same people would double them.
